Well about 2 months ago I bought a 5 disc dvd player from Best Buy. It plays NTSC and PAL according to the book. BUt I have only used it for NTSC. It has an AM/FM Tuner with 5.1 Surround sound. It has played everything I have thrown at it, DVD's and VCD's. It has performed more than what I expected. IT is a Koss and I payed $149.00 plus tax. It works great for me. Hope that helps.
